The Eye of Horus, also known as Udyat, is an ancient Egyptian symbol representing the right eye of Horus, a deity from Egyptian mythology. This symbol has deep religious and cultural meaning and is widely used in Egyptian symbology. Here are some key aspects associated with the Eye of Horus:
Symbol of Protection and Power:
    - The Eye of Horus was considered a powerful protective amulet. It was believed to offer protection, healing and magical power.
   - Horus was a deity associated with the sky, the sun and war. The Eye of Horus symbolizes his right eye, which was damaged during a battle with Seth, the god of chaos.
Symbol of Integrity:
    - The Eye of Horus is also associated with Integrity and completeness. Legend has it that Thoth, the god of wisdom, healed and restored the damaged eye of Horus, thus symbolizing restoration and balance.
Component Parts:
    - The symbol is made up of several parts, each with a specific meaning. For example, the upper part represents smell, the middle eyebrow symbolizes sight, while the lower part represents touch.
Use in Mummification:
    - The Eye of Horus was often used during mummification rituals to protect the deceased on their journey to the afterlife.
Associated with the Ankh:
    - In some representations, the Eye of Horus can be combined with the Ankh, another powerful Egyptian symbol representing eternal life. This combination symbolizes eternal life protected by Horus.
    - Today, the Eye of Horus is still a popular symbol and is often used as a jewel or amulet for protection and as an artistic decoration in cultural and esoteric contexts.
The Eye of Horus is a symbol rich in history and meaning, reflecting the mythology and spirituality of ancient Egypt. Its presence has been prominent in ancient beliefs and continues to influence modern culture.
